The dermatome at the nipple line is:

Correct answer: AT4

Key dermatome landmarks: C5 = lateral arm (regimental badge) / T4 = nipple line / T6 = xiphisternum / T10 = umbilicus / T12 = inguinal ligament / L1 = groin / L3 = knee / L5 = great toe web space / S1 = lateral foot / S2-S4 = perineum.
